API Documentation

InfoCard/Adapter/Default.php

Includes Classes 
category
Zend
copyright
Copyright (c) 2005-2010 Zend Technologies USA Inc. (http://www.zend.com)
license
http://framework.zend.com/license/new-bsd New BSD License
package
Zend_InfoCard
subpackage
Adapter
version
$Id: Default.php 20096 2010-01-06 02:05:09Z bkarwin $
Classes
Zend_InfoCard_Adapter_Default

Description

Zend Framework

LICENSE

This source file is subject to the new BSD license that is bundled with this package in the file LICENSE.txt. It is also available through the world-wide-web at this URL: http://framework.zend.com/license/new-bsd If you did not receive a copy of the license and are unable to obtain it through the world-wide-web, please send an email to license@zend.com so we can send you a copy immediately.

Zend_InfoCard_Adapter_Default

Implements
Zend_InfoCard_Adapter_Interface
category
Zend
copyright
Copyright (c) 2005-2010 Zend Technologies USA Inc. (http://www.zend.com)
license
http://framework.zend.com/license/new-bsd New BSD License
package
Zend_InfoCard
subpackage
Adapter
Methods
storeAssertion
retrieveAssertion
removeAssertion

Description

The default InfoCard component Adapter which serves as a pass-thru placeholder for developers. Initially developed to provide a callback mechanism to store and retrieve assertions as part of the validation process it can be used anytime callback facilities are necessary

Methods

removeAssertion

removeAssertion( string $assertionURI, string $assertionID ) : bool

Remove an assertion (pass-thru does nothing)

Arguments
$assertionURI
string
The assertion type URI
$assertionID
string
The assertion ID to remove
Output
bool
Always returns true (false on removal failure)
Details
visibility
public
final
false
static
false

retrieveAssertion

retrieveAssertion( string $assertionURI, string $assertionID ) : mixed

Retrieve an assertion (pass-thru does nothing)

Arguments
$assertionURI
string
The assertion type URI
$assertionID
string
The assertion ID to retrieve
Output
mixed
False if the assertion ID was not found for that URI, or an array of conditions associated with that assertion if found (always returns false)
Details
visibility
public
final
false
static
false

storeAssertion

storeAssertion( string $assertionURI, string $assertionID, array $conditions ) : bool

Store the assertion (pass-thru does nothing)

Arguments
$assertionURI
string
The assertion type URI
$assertionID
string
The specific assertion ID
$conditions
array
An array of claims to store associated with the assertion
Output
bool
Always returns true (would return false on store failure)
Details
visibility
public
final
false
static
false
Documentation was generated by DocBlox.